Is there a US Consular Agency office in Puerto Plata? Came across a Consular Information Sheet dated 9/26/01 on internet that indicated there was an office at Calle Beller 51, 2nd floor, office 6, phone 586-4204.

Does anyone know if the office is still open? Supposedly expatriates and visitors can register and/or get information/assistance there Monday-Friday, 9-12, 2:30-5pm.

The address & Tel No. were correct when I left that building just over a year ago (I worked two offices up the corridor, in the same office as the British Consul). I was in there 2 months ago & the girl behind the desk remained the same as before so I presume it is still the same office & personnel.

HB is right (when is he ever NOT??) Bill Kirkman might still be the official US Consular Agent - but it could easily have been paased over for his son to manage. Bill used to go in on Tuesday or Thursday mornings but would make "Special" arrangements for other days if he had to. If you get no success from the girl in the office (Angella as I recall) try getting hold of Bill at Sea Horse Ranch near Sosua - He owns that place!
